Antioxidants play a vital role in maintaining our overall health, particularly when it comes to brain function. As we age, our bodies become more susceptible to oxidative stress, a condition caused by an imbalance between free radicals and antioxidants in the body. This imbalance is linked to several neurodegenerative diseases, cognitive decline, and even issues such as anxiety and depression.
